Результаты поиска по запросу "mpi"
Почему MPI_Iprobe возвращает false, когда сообщение определенно было отправлено?
Я хочу использовать MPI_Iprobe, чтобы проверить, ожидает ли уже сообщение с данным тегом. Однако поведение MPI_Iprobe не совсем то, что я ожидал. В приведенном ниже примере я отправляю сообщения из нескольких задач в одну задачу (ранг 0). ...
Установка MPI для Windows
Я пытаюсь установить MPI для Windows 8, поэтому, когда я искал net, у меня были шаги для установки его на XP / 7, но не для Windows 8. ...
Параллельные вычисления с кластерами, отличными от снежного SOCK
Недавнее добавление прямой поддержки параллельных вычислений в R2.14 вызвало у меня вопрос. Существует множество вариантов создания кластеров в R. Я используюsnow Кластеры SOCK регулярно, но я знаю, что есть и другие способы, такие как MPI. Я ...
Утечка памяти MPI
Я пишу некоторый код, который использует MPI, и я продолжал замечать некоторые утечки памяти при запуске его с valgrind. Пытаясь определить, где была проблема, я закончил с этим простым (и совершенно бесполезным) основным: #include ...
MPI последовательная основная функция
Это довольно простой вопрос MPI, но я не могу обойти его. У меня есть основная функция, которая вызывает другую функцию, которая использует MPI. Я хочу, чтобы основная функция выполнялась последовательно, а другая - параллельно. Мой ...
Является ли MPI_Reduce блокирующим (или естественным барьером)?
У меня есть фрагмент кода ниже в C ++, который в основном вычисляет пи с использованием классической техники Монте-Карло. srand48((unsigned)time(0) + my_rank); for(int i = 0 ; i < part_points; i++) { double x = drand48(); double y = drand48(); ...
отправка блоков двумерного массива в C с использованием MPI
Как вы отправляете блоки 2-D массива на разные процессоры? Предположим, размер 2D-массива равен 400x400, и я хочу отправить блоки размером 100X100 на разные процессоры. Идея состоит в том, что каждый процессор будет выполнять вычисления на своем ...
Как ускорить эту проблему с помощью MPI
(1). Мне интересно, как я могу ускорить трудоемкие вычисления в цикле моего кода ниже, используя MPI? int main(int argc, char ** argv) { // some operations f(size); // some operations return 0; } void f(int size) { // some operations int i; ...
Ошибка в построении MPI надстройки в MSVC 2010
Я установил openmpi в C: \ Program Files \ OpenMPI_v1.5.4-win32 \ и хочу скомпилировать boost для создания параллельной графу библиотеки. Но получил следующую ошибку: The system cannot find the path specified. The system cannot find the ...
запись матрицы в один текстовый файл с MPI
У меня есть огромная матрица, которую я разделил на несколько подматриц и произвел некоторые вычисления. После этих вычислений я должен записать эту матрицу в один файл для последующей обработки. Можно ли записать результаты в один текстовый файл ...